An Official Harper?

Writers: Emma, Patrick
Date Posted: 11th March 2007

Characters: Kouna, Thanja
Description: Kouna and Thanja discuss the Hall's lack of a harper.
Location: Dolphin Hall
Date: month 3, day 5 of Turn 4


"Hallsecond," said Thanja rather formally as she spotted the Dolphin Hallsecond.

"Hallsecond Thanja, how nice to see you again." Kouna said happily. "If you have a minute I'd like to discuss something concerning our Halls." She grinned to show it was nothing pressing.

"Of course, I'd be only too happy to spend a moment or two with you." She smiled at the other woman.

"It'll only take a moment." She assured her fellow Hallsecond. "I was just very surprised at the lack of official harper at our Hall. How long has it been that way?" Kouna asked.

"I really don't know," replied Thanja. "Although we're so close now..."

"Exactly. I heard about the dolphins special concert, and with so many of our dolphineers settling down to start families we're going to need a teacher soon."
She grinned at her own lack of children. Maybe someday. "What would we need to provide for a Harper.
We don't have any precidences about gender obviously, and but what is it that we need to supply them with?"
A pad of paper and a pen was instantly in her hands, as if appearing from the ether.

"You might be better off talking to the Hallmaster himself on that. I can advise you generally, but as to specifics you'd need a Harper rather than a Printer."

"Of course. But I'd like to know we _have_ the basics before I talk to him." She was almost nervous to talk to the Harper Hallmaster. Almost. "And if you know of anyone whose ready for a change, I'd like to learn they're names so I can start corrupting them to the Dolphin Hall." She grinned mischeviously.

"Well I can't give any names, but I can tell you that there are a few promising Journeymen and Women who'd jump at the chance if a posting were to come up. How about Hallmaster Mosler writes to the Hallmaster here, and I'll do what I can to advance the application?"
suggested Thanja. "Wonderful! I'll get Mosler right on it." Kouna wrote herself a note on her hand. "Now would they generally want a closed apartment? Or would they want to mingle with the Hall folk?"

"Totally depends on the person."

"Well of course it does," Kouna continued on rather bluntly. "But of those you _know_ are getting antsy what is the general preference. I want to make sure that our Hall can house them comfortably."

"How about I get back to you later today?"

"Or better yet I'll send Via along later today and you can send me what you find out." Kouna said stroking the golden head of her firelizard who was perched on her shoulder. "And thank you Hallsecond Thanja. I was very set on getting this rolling today." She held out her hand to her fellow Hallsecond.

Thanja took the hand and shook it. "I'll look out for her."
